## Sortwright Report Builder: Sort Stability

The Sortwright engine guarantees stable sorting only when the `stable_merge` flag is enabled in the tenant config. If a customer reports rows reordering between identical runs, first confirm the flag, then check whether any column uses a locale-sensitive collator, since those fall back to an unstable quicksort on worker nodes older than the Maple release. Re-run the report with tracing enabled and attach the output to the incident. The trace emits its identifier immediately below this line.

session token of yahof-bajeg = htk9_0d43d44ed

## Deploying the Gatewick Proctor Queue

Deploys are pretty painless: push to main, wait for the pipeline, then watch the queue drain dashboard for five minutes. If candidates pile up mid-exam, roll back first and ask questions later — the queue replays safely. Everything the workers care about lives in one config block, shown here for reference.

settings of bafof-yagef:
JOROX_PIN=8740
JOROX_TENANT=pelox
JOROX_METRICS_HOST=metrics.jorox.qorvelworks.internal
JOROX_SEAL=seal_c78f63c1
JOROX_STANDBY_TEAM=norax

Subject: Nightly reindex — what you need to know

Welcome aboard. The Quillsearch nightly reindex kicks off at 01:30 and normally finishes by 03:00. If it's still running at 04:00, it will page you. First move: check the shard allocator logs, not the crawler — the crawler almost never fails. Safe actions: pause, resume, or restart the allocator. Never delete a partial index; stale results are acceptable until morning, missing results are not. The full runbook with commands and escalation order is on the page below.

runbook for badug-kadup: https://confluence.zemvarlabs.internal/projects/browse/display/projects/bd1b

Welcome to the Quillhaven broker upgrade effort. We are moving from Ferrobus 2 to 3, which changes how partitions are rebalanced under load. Expect consumer lag spikes during cutover windows, so drain queues below 10k messages first and verify replica health on the Sablemont nodes. The tuning constants we will apply cluster-wide are listed below.

limits module of fajeg-fajef:
QUOTAS = {
    "oliath": 5,
    "ralael": 1,
    "ulawyn": 10,
    "holael": 2,
}